The diversified collection of the Social Sciences Department addresses human relationships and experiences in their social, political and religious contexts.
Materials cover the Library of Congress classifications B, GF-GV, H, HM-HV, J, K, and L.
From legal codes to points of etiquette, most social concerns are covered here. The wide range of subjects includes aging, anthropology, costumes, dance, folklore, the occult, sports & games, sociology, crime, education, death, international relations, government, and law. Special strengths of the department are psychology, religion, baseball, social reform, women, international law, and education.
